#d16c29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d16c29 is composed of 82% red, 42.4%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 80.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 23.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 49%. #d16c29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d852 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d16c29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d16c29 has RGB values of R:209, G:108,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.8,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13724713.

Shades and Tints of #d16c29
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0602 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d16c29
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847c76 is the less saturated color, while #f76403 is the most saturated one.
